Pork Belly

Difficulty
Medium
Prep time
15 minutes
Prep time
65 minutes
Total time
1 hour 20 minutes
Yield
6 servings

Ingredients

  • 12 oz pork belly
  • ¾ C salt
  • For spice mix:
  • 2 tbsp lemon pepper
  • 2 tbsp paprika
  • 1 tsp salt
  • for the guacamole:
  • 1 avocado
  • 2 tomatoes, diced
  • 1 onion, diced
  • 1 bunch cilantro, chopped
  • Juice from 1 lemon
  • For the pickled red onion
  • 1 red onion, thinly sliced
  • â…“ C ap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tbsp sugar

Instructions

  1. Place pork belly skin-side down and use a knife to score the meat in a cross-hatch. Season with paprika and lemon pepper.
  2. Place over aluminum foil and cook for 20 minutes,
  3. Turn the pork belly so it’s skin-side up, pour salt over the skin and spread evenly so that a thick coat covers all of it.
  4. Fold the aluminum foil along the sides soonly the top of the pork belly is visible. Place inside the Bella Air Fryer and cook for 25-30 minutes.
  5. Remove from the air fryer and scrape off the salt crust. Place back in the Bella Air Fryer again and cook another 15 minutes until skin becomes crispy. Let cool.
  6. To make the guacamole, open the avocado, discard the pit and scoop the fruit into a small bowl. Add tomatoes, onion and cilantro. Mix to combine, then season with lemon juice and salt.
  7. For the onion side, place the sliced red onion in a small bowl. Add apple cider vinegar and sugar. Set aside to infuse for 15-20 minutes.
  8. Serve the pork belly sliced, with guacamole and pickled onions.
